If you aren't familiar with Sigma, they make wonderful high quality makeup brushes very similar to MAC brushes, in fact, there are may Sigma brushes that are MAC dupes but for a MUCH lower price. I have raved about Sigma brushes like the F80 flat-top synthetic kabuki brush for applying foundation flawlessly and with zero shedding! There is a great selection for all sorts of brushes from beginner to professional as well as a vegan brush line that is fantastic. You can buy them individually or buy one of their many sets, either way I know you will be satisfied.
